No, this isn’t a drill ladies and gentlemen. The UEFA Champions League is back, and this Saturday, Bayern Munich have a game to play.
After winning 3-0 at Stamford Bridge last February, Bayern still have one more game to play against Chelsea to decide who goes through to the single-legged Quarterfinals in Lisbon.
This time around, we brought on We Ain’t Got No History’s Andre Carlisle to talk about injuries and results at the end of Chelsea’s season. However, it should be mentioned, we recorded this the day before the FA Cup Final where Arsenal dispatched the Blues in a game that saw Christian Pulisic go down with an injury.
Nevertheless, we talk about the American and many other subjects in our latest episode:
Hello! Welcome to Der Ausblick, a show where we look ahead to the big matchups ahead for FC Bayern Munich. We will be releasing these episodes each week on the day before each game, including UEFA Champions League, Bundesliga, and Pokal matches.
On this episode, we take a look at Chelsea F.C. The team finished their season in 4th place with 66 points on 20 wins, 6 draws and 12 losses. We’re joined by someone from our Chelsea sister blog, We Ain’t Got No History, contributor Andre Carlisle. Jake and Andre sit down to discuss the end to Chelsea’s Premier League season, the injured list for the Blues, the performances of first year winger Christian Pulisic, the results of Frank Lampard in his first year as manager, the incoming class of attacking talent, and much more!
